Q. What’s the most expensive mistake you’ve made at work?


A. I met both Carl Page and Larry Page at a party hosted by a Stanford friend of mine in 1998. Carl gave me his card for eGroups and said “we’re hiring”. Larry gave me his card for Google—a flimsy bit of paper obviously printed by bubble jet—and said “we’re hiring”. I said, “Nah, who needs another search engine?” and went to graduate school. I still have the card. (Zestyping)

Android and Tweetdeck Fathers Reply to Steve Jobs Putdowns

Android and Tweetdeck Fathers Reply to Steve Jobs Putdowns: "

As you may have some knowledge of if you were listening to the Apple earnings call yesterday, Steve Jobs himself let himself be heard on more than one subject, with some choice words for brands such as Android and Tweetdeck. Now there’s a bit of reply on the part of Andy Rubin (father of Android), and Iain Dodsworth (CEO of TweetDeck) through their Twitter accounts. Both of them aren’t exactly pleased with situation, but both seem to have kept their witty humor intact for the jab back.




During the talk yesterday, Jobs stated such things as TweetDeck having to “contend with more than a hundred different versions of Android” and that it was “a daunting challenge.” To which Dodsworth, as you can see, simply says, “Did we at any point say it was a nightmare developing on Android? Errr nope, no we didn’t. It wasn’t” Maybe the lines got crossed somewhere in that exchange.


Then there’s Rubin, who had to reply to Jobs comment: “We are very committed to the integrated approach, no matter how many times Google characterizes it as closed, and we believe that it will triumph over the fragmented approach, no matter how any times Google characterizes it as open.” Rubin replies in a much more subtle way: with a line of code, in his own way, explaining what “open” means. The code, in fact, when entered into Terminal, does thus: creates a folder named “android”, changes to that folder, initializes the “repo” program with the Android source host, downloads the source, and compiles Android. Like, open, man, open.

The lost art of video game cartography

The lost art of video game cartography: "

We don't make maps of games anymore. Is that bad thing?

If you've been playing games since the ZX Spectrum era you'll remember there was once an essential piece of gaming kit that didn't need to be plugged into the back of your machine. It was a pad of blank paper. In the early days of interactive entertainment, making your own maps was a vital tool for progression. With the classic text-based adventures – from Will Crowther's Colossal Cave, through the Zork series and Scott Adams' cryptic quests – it was the only way players could visualise the experience amid the onslaught of verb-noun inputs and endless compass references.

Later, with the dawn of the graphical action adventure, the homemade map remained an important navigational device. Fans of Ultimate's classic isometric quests, Knight Lore, Alien 8 and Sabre Wulf, would pride themselves on their elaborate cartographic creations (at least in my school), while attempting to accurately chart Mike Singleton's epic Lords of Midnight, with its 4000 unique locations, was the eighties equivalent of Waldseemüller's Universalis Cosmographia. Keen gamer/mappers would compare techniques and send their works into the tips sections at magazines like ZZap 64 and Crash. Some favoured naturalistic approximations of the game environments, creating miniaturised ordinance survey maps. Others, like myself, used graph paper and went for a more diagrammatic approach, inspired by the topographic purity of Harry Beck's tube map.

But in the late-eighties, game design changed. The big home consoles from Nintendo and Sega brought an endless stream of slick arcade conversions – no one needed to map Altered Beast or R-Type. And while early Japanese RPG titles like Final Fantasy and Legend of Zelda initially required some mapping skills thanks to their burgeoning use of open world 'overmap' environments, later iterations brought in a variety of navigational aids. Breath of Fire II, for example, introduced world maps that opened up new sections as the player gained fresh abilities, effectively allowing the micro-management of exploration and lessening the chances of getting lost (a theme that would later expand into the whole hub world concept, championed by Super Mario 64). Then there were teleportation zones, and the ability to set waypoints across a map screen – somewhere along the line, travel became an inconvenience rather than the point of the game.

Elsewhere, CD-Rom technology allowed the birth of the cinematic adventure, complete with FMV and CGI story sequences. This heavily story-based form of design required a linear structure, with choke points and bottle necks to host key plot changes. That's pretty much where we are with big action adventure titles like Tomb Raider, Uncharted, Batman: Arkham Asylum and Call of Duty. The whole concept of exploration has changed; we no longer need to explore to progress, we explore to find power-ups and hidden extras, and in this overtly stage-managed form of freedom, cartography isn't really necessary. The pictorial map has been replaced by the didactic walkthrough.

Even so-called 'open world' titles are map-free experiences. There will usually be a mini-map or radar display in the corner as well as an HUD that paints your required destination with big arrows and a distance read-out. In games like Doom and Resident Evil, which require endless revisitation of old map sections, exploration becomes a sort of neurotic dance, an insect triangulation, in which the route maps are burned on the memory like rhythm-action button presses.

Do we really, truly explore game worlds anymore? Can we? I think in some ways, this goes deeper than mere changes in game design. It's interesting that GPS technology has evolved into a mass mainstream phenomenon at the same time as games; both are now about ridding us of the need to understand and read our environments. There have been a few titles that have attempted to engage us in map-making again – the DS RPG Etrian Odyssey requires you to draw your own map on the touch screen, while Legend of Zelda: Phantom Hourglass lets your customise and add notes to the pre-designed map display. But these are rare novelties.

I miss game maps. There was something fundamentally immersive about creating your own interpretation of the virtual environment, of relying on your own systems and diagrams to get you through. I could be wrong of course, there may be dozens of titles I've missed that positively invite cartographic interaction – if so let us know in the comments section. I suspect not. We are, as a race, moving toward a guided, systematic form of orientation in which anything worth seeing has already been geo-tagged, reviewed and Google mapped. Getting lost in a game, or in a city, is now a completely unnecessary annoyance. It was once a means of discovering amazing things.

What If Google’s Social Layer Is Chrome? What If Facebook Builds A Browser?

What If Google’s Social Layer Is Chrome? What If Facebook Builds A Browser?: "



Since being wrestled back from Microsoft’s death grip, the web browser has thrived thanks to its openness. All of the popular browsers beyond IE — Firefox, Chrome, Safari, Opera — are either based on open-source or have a thriving community that helps develop and expand each of them. And it’s relatively easy for a user to switch between any of them. But what if that were to change?


I have no direct knowledge that this is about to happen, but recent conversations have had me thinking about this. What if say, Google, in their attempt to finally create a cohesive social experience, decided to forgo building yet another service and instead went for the ultimate layer: the browser?


They could do this, of course, because they make the Chrome web browser. Just imagine a web experience where you signed in once and that was it. For the rest of the time you used that browser, everything would be set for you. Notifications, instant messages, status updates — those would all come in and go out through Chrome, not some website you have open within Chrome.


That may sound weird, but we’re not that far away from this personalization of the browser. Consider that Chrome’s Omnibox (the URL bar and search box) is already a Google zone. Sure, you can set it to use another search engine, but how many people do you think actually do that? And now that Google Instant is being integrated into it, it seems like the connection will only get stronger.


And shortly, Chrome will have its own Web App Store. These apps (some of which will be paid) will only run in Chrome itself. And the payment mechanism and DRM will have to be run through the browser.


How will that work? Presumably, you’ll have to be signed in to your Google account when using the browser. Google has already put some of this in place by enticing people to put their credentials in to the browser for things like bookmark sync. And the latest builds of Chromium make it very clear that you’re signed into the browser, not some website.


Oh yeah, and there’s this thing called Chrome OS which is due to launch shortly. How do you think that will work? Yep, you’ll be logged in to your Google account the entire time. From what I’ve heard, the basic high-level thought is that Chrome OS and Chrome are the same thing. One is simply going to be an operating system within another operating system (Windows, OS X, or Linux), while the other won’t have that additional layer. But functionality-wise, they’ll be the same.


Other attempts have been made at social web browsers — notably, Flock. But Chrome has been smart to slowly integrate personalizations over time. And they have two killer features: Google services and the fastest browser. Now that Chrome is approaching 100 million users, it may be getting close to the time that Google could strike with a fully social browsing experience.



Undoubtedly such a move would garner backlash, but Google could point people in the direction of Chromium, the open-source browser on which Chrome is based. The truth is that right now, Chromium is little more than a testing ground for Chrome. But what if it truly became the open-source alternative to the Google proprietary browser? Again, none of this sounds that far-fetched to me.


We want people to be more logged in to Google,” CEO Eric Schmidt said last week. Having an always-on presence at the browser level could certainly achieve that. Google would be able to see everything you do on the web. And they would be smart enough to make you opt-in to this. All in the name of serving you better content, I’m sure.


To see an even more extreme version of this model in action, you only have to look at Android and the iPhone. With each of those platforms, you sign-in not at the browser level, but at the system level. Again, this is all done in the name of ease (which is very real), but it also gives both Google and Apple access to a huge amount of data about you.


And if you think the web isn’t going to move that way, you’re dreaming. Even if it isn’t Google that pulls off the ultimate Chrome web browser, rival Facebook just might.


They haven’t given any indication that they want to be in the actual browser space, but Google didn’t either before they dropped Chrome in our laps. And Facebook CEO Mark Zuckerberg has made a lot of comments recently suggesting that there needs to be a better way for users to sign-in once on some system and forget about it. Facebook Connect is sort of that. But it doesn’t go deep enough, and Zuckerberg knows it.


That’s why the notion of a Facebook Phone isn’t so crazy. It would require years of work, but just look at what Google and Apple are doing now. A Facebook browser would be a shorter-term solution to some of what Facebook undoubtedly wants to do.


You might laugh at the notion of a Facebook web browser, but be honest: how many of your friends would use it? Probably a lot. If it had chat, alerts, and, of course, the News Feed, it would be a huge hit. You could visit any site on the web, but you’d be already logged in to your Facebook account. And you’d have one-click access to all your Facebook credits to buy whatever you wanted.


And it would be huge for sharing.


The more I think about this, the more I think it would be crazy for Facebook not to do this. Because Google is going to. And Google and Apple already have a huge head start on this deep integration thanks to their mobile platforms. Facebook is in the middle of a race they haven’t even started running yet.


Again, I have no concrete evidence on any of this, but I have this feeling that web browsing as we know it is about to change. For us, such a shift would be both good and bad. But for the web powers that be, it would be all good.

3D Lego printer

3D Lego printer: "


The MakerLegoBot is a Lego Mindstorms-based 3D printer that turns software descriptions of Lego builds into completed Lego pieces, automatically, picking and snapping down pieces as it goes. Next step would be a MakerLegoBot that prints other MakerLegoBots, of course:



A Java Application that runs on the PC takes an .ldr MLCad file, determines a set of print instructions, and then sends the instructions via USB over to the MakerLegoBot for printing...


The core concept that makes 3D print of Legos possible is the sticky grab and axle release mechanism. The printer head selects from an array of Lego bricks, moves to the correct location, and then places each Lego in its determined spot...


It took many nights and many iterations to get the feed system working consistently. The current design works with 1x2, 2x2, 3x2, 4x2, and 8x2 Lego bricks. Once a brick is grabbed, the next brick in line falls into place.




MakerLegoBot: A Lego Mindstorms NXT 3D Lego Printer
